Abstract

One or more aspects of the present disclosure relate to enhancing modular device snapshot-to-encryption-key associations. In embodiments, an input/output (IO) workload can be received at a storage array. The IO workload can include an IO request to write encrypted data on the storage array. The IO request's metadata can also be parsed for information such as snap parameters. Further, an encryption key identifier (ID) can be received from a host, and snapshots of a storage unit can be created with the parsed information and the key ID.
